Geraldton Diocese Appoints New Director of Music

The Diocese of Geraldton is pleased to announce that Jacinta Jakovcevic has been appointed as the Diocesan Director of Music for the Diocese.   Jacinta comes to this position with a wealth of knowledge and experience.

One of Australia’s foremost liturgical musicians, she was appointed to the National Liturgical Music Council (Australian Catholic Bishops Conference) and gives presentations at national conferences on liturgical music. She also sits on the National Council of the Royal School of Church Music (RSCM) Australia and is the chairman of the West Australian branch of the RSCM.

Jacinta is also nationally recognised as an organist and performs both internationally and nationally.

She has also taken part in ABC broadcasts and extensive work with major organisations including the West Australian Symphony Orchestra (WASO), Western Australian Academy of Performing Arts (WAAPA), the University of Western Australia and the Australian Opera Studio.

Appointed organist in 2000 and then Director of Music in 2008 at St Mary’s Cathedral Perth, Jacinta established many programmes for the development of young people in Church music including the Cathedral Choir’s special training programme for young boy trebles, the Young Organists Programme, the Cathedral’s Organ Scholarship, a Cantor training programme and the Orchestral Mass project.

She also established many opportunities for the Church conecting to the wider community including the Cathedral’s Concert Series, Community Singing series, and hosted many national and leading international artists at the Cathedral including, The Sixteen (UK), the Tallis Scholars (UK) and Johann Vexo (France).

Jacinta is currently establishing a young people’s/children’s choir in Geraldton at St Francis Xavier Cathedral. She is also available to provide tuition for children and adults to play the piano and pipe organ located in St Francis Xavier Cathedral in Geraldton, which is a powerful and fantastic instrument.
